This bisque headed beauty is an early example of the work of the Armand Marseilles firm which became for a time the world's largest doll or parts maker. The attributes of this doll illustrate the reason for this success.

The delicate rosy cheeks and eyes make the feminine beauty come alive in this doll which has a kid leather body. Her mouth is slightly open, her eyes brown to match her long, attached hair. She does not have a removable wig.

She is fully costumed with floor length dress, petticoat, bloomers, shoes. Her legs are jointed at the hip and knee. The dress is accompanied with a matching evening bag.

The back of her head is marked Ruth 5/0. Given the absence of Germany or AM marks, I conclude that the doll is late 19th C.

The face is in excellent condition. The body is very good though there is some discoloration on the hands. The arms are attached to the shoulders with stitching rather than with bolt.

Dimensions
Height: 18 inches
